About Me

I am passionate about growth and healing and have experience with several different types of therapy we may use in session as needed. I enjoy utilizing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) therapy to assist clients on their therapy journey. I have experience working with adults experiencing anxiety, depression, life transitions, work stress, trauma, grief, and low self-esteem. I also work extensively with people who want to address gender, race, health, and social issues impacting their lives. I often work with women’s health issues, LGBTQIA+ populations, college students, healthcare workers and therapists. Common life transitions that folks may be seeking therapy for include relationship changes (from wedding stress to break-ups, I've seen it all!), job and education shifts, setting boundaries with parents or family members as a young adult, experiencing imposter-syndrome for the first time or trying to manage stress of life changes that are out of our control.

Education & Experience

I graduated with a bachelor's degree in Counseling and Human Services from the University of Scranton (yes, the town from The Office) in 2016 and a master’s degree in Clinical Mental Health Counseling from Duquesne University in 2018. My career started working with adults with substance use disorders and later pivoted to working with adults who experienced trauma. I later spent 3 years working with adult survivors of intimate partner violence before opening my private practice where I specialize in providing trauma-responsive care to adults across Ohio.
